What was Kareem Abdul-Jabbar's signature shot?

The hook shot became a trademark of Kareem Abdul-Jabbar, the National Basketball Association's all-time leading scorer, who was proficient at the shot at a much greater distance from the basket than most players.

Who has the most hook shots in NBA history?

Kareem Abdul-Jabbar, as Alcindor became known following his conversion to Islam, would go on to develop the most devastating hook shot in basketball history. The “skyhook” perfected by the 7-foot-2 Abdul-Jabbar helped him score an NBA-record 38,327 career points.

Who is known for the skyhook?

Abdul-Jabbar's even has an incredible name: skyhook. That's the term Bucks broadcaster Eddie Doucette used to describe the iconic shot Abdul-Jabbar made to win Game 6 of the 1974 NBA Finals.

How good was Wilt Chamberlain actually?

Chamberlain ended his career with a total of 31,419 total points, which at the time was an NBA record. He also ended his career with 23,924 total rebounds, which is still an NBA record. His 4,643 career assists are still the most for an NBA center, and many of his scoring records will simply never be touched.

How many Hall of Famers did Wilt play against?

Chamberlain played in 29 post-season series in his career, and in the process, he faced a HOF starting center in 19 of them (Russell in eight; Thurmond in three; Reed in two; Kareem in two; Bellamy, in two; Lucas in one; and borderline HOFer, Wayne Embry in one.)

What percentage of Skyhooks did Kareem make?

Kareem was a 56 percent shooter for his career and had only one season -- his last, in 1988-89 -- in which he failed to make at least half of his shots.
